Ga. celebration of life, S.C. funeral set for late Angie Stone
AUGUSTA, Ga. (WRDW/WAGT) - A Georgia celebration of life service and South Carolina funeral have been set for the late R&B singer Angie Stone next week.
On Friday, March 14, the celebration of life will be held at World of Faith Cathedral in Austell at 11 a.m. Attendees must online.

Stone’s funeral is scheduled for noon the next day at First Nazareth Baptist Church in her hometown of Columbia, South Carolina.
Stone, 63, was best known as a member of the hip-trio the Sequence and for her solo career. The Grammy-nominated artist and longtime metro Atlanta resident was killed in a crash in Montgomery, Alabama, on March 1.
In the wake of her death, the public and several celebrities have taken to social media to mourn — including some from Atlanta.

On Instagram, Tyler Perry said Stone’s music inspired him while he was writing “Straw,” an show on Netflix.
“I don’t know what’s going on with so many people leaving this planet, but what I do know is that death is a door that we all will face one day. And I pray that my life has touched folks the way she touched so many,” he wrote.
